They also connect directly to NFT utility, the real-world or digital function an NFT provides beyond its visual design. A BATH NFT might let you participate in a game, access a private community, or even earn crypto rewards over time. That’s different from a profile picture NFT that’s just a status symbol. Utility matters because it creates demand that lasts. Projects that build real use cases—like access to tools, services, or experiences—tend to survive market downturns.
